Tailoring Endoscopic Approach to Colloid Cysts of the Third Ventricle: A Multicenter Experience.
Endoscopic removal of third ventricular colloid cysts has grown in popularity. The biggest issues concern radicality, cure or at least long-term control of the disease, and endoscopic remnants. Technologic advances in instrumentation and introduction of novel tools have greatly improved endoscopic results. Deeper knowledge of surrounding anatomy and awareness that colloid cysts vary in their position (foraminal or retroforaminal) can further improve with the selection of a tailored approach for each patient. ⋯ A traditional precoronal transforaminal approach should be considered only for pure foraminal cysts (group A), as the retroforaminal component is poorly controlled. Retroforaminal cysts (groups B and C) should be resected through a retroforaminal transpellucidum interfornicialis route. A supraorbital transforaminal approach is a more versatile approach suitable for most cases.

Chronic subdural hematoma (CSDH) often occurs in association with cerebrospinal fluid (CSF) hypovolemia. Many cases with CSDH due to CSF hypovolemia and treated by burr hole surgery have been reported to present with paradoxical deterioration. However, the mechanisms and pathology of deterioration after surgery for CSDH due to CSF hypovolemia remain obscure. ⋯ SDFC deteriorating after surgery has never been reported. SDFC has communication with CSF differing from mature CSDH composed of closed cavity surrounded by neomembrane. Under situations of CSF hypovolemia due to spinal dural tear, opening the cranium can prompt air replacement in the CSF space, which might represent a substantial risk for central herniation caused by a rapid loss of buoyancy force.

Rod Fracture After Apparently Solid Radiographic Fusion in Adult Spinal Deformity Patients.
Rod fracture occurs with delayed fusion or pseudarthrosis after adult spinal deformity (ASD) surgery. Rod fracture after apparent radiographic fusion has not been previously investigated. ⋯ Rod fracture occurred in 9.5% of patients with apparently solid radiographic fusion after ASD surgery. Advanced age, obesity, small diameter rods (5.5 mm), osteotomy, and lower comorbidity burden were significantly associated with rod fracture. Nearly one-half of these patients noted worsening pain, and 21.1% required revision surgery. Instrumentation failure may occur and may be symptomatic even in the setting of apparent fusion on plain radiographs.

Choosing the fusion level for posterior fusion in patients with Lenke 5C adolescent idiopathic scoliosis (AIS) is highly associated with coronal balance. Previous studies indicated that in patients with lowest end vertebra tilt >25°, surgeons could extend distal fusion to avoid coronal imbalance (CIB). This study aimed to assess the risk factors for CIB in Lenke 5C scoliosis and to discuss how to select fusion level. ⋯ Distal fusion extension at LEV+1 is more likely to result in CIB at the first and final follow-up, especially when the bending lumbosacral hemicurve is >15°. Fusion at LEV+1 should not be chosen when LEV is at L4.

Sacroiliac (SI) joint motion is complex and is poorly understood overall. In this study we evaluated a new biomechanical method developed to provide more insight into SI joint movement and to elucidate biomechanical changes after SI joint fusion surgery in a one-leg standing model. ⋯ This study suggests that our new biomechanical method for SI joint evaluation may provide improved insight into SI joint movement and biomechanical changes after SI joint fusion surgery in a one-leg standing model.
